diff --git a/test/CXX/temp/temp.spec/temp.explicit/p3.cpp b/test/CXX/temp/temp.spec/temp.explicit/p3.cpp new file mode 100644 index 000000000000..2bd781bbed28 --- /dev/null +++ b/test/CXX/temp/temp.spec/temp.explicit/p3.cpp @@ -0,0 +1,55 @@ +// RUN: clang-cc -fsyntax-only -verify %s + +// A declaration of a function template shall be in scope at the point of the +// explicit instantiation of the function template. +template<typename T> void f0(T) { } +template void f0(int); // okay + +// A definition of the class or class template containing a member function +// template shall be in scope at the point of the explicit instantiation of +// the member function template. +struct X0; // expected-note 2{{forward declaration}} +template<typename> struct X1; // expected-note 2{{declared here}} \ + // expected-note 3{{forward declaration}} + +// FIXME: Repeated diagnostics here! +template void X0::f0<int>(int); // expected-error 2{{incomplete type}} \ + // expected-error{{invalid token after}} +template void X1<int>::f0<int>(int); // expected-error{{implicit instantiation of undefined template}} \ + // expected-error{{incomplete type}} \\ + // expected-error{{invalid token}} + +// A definition of a class template or class member template shall be in scope +// at the point of the explicit instantiation of the class template or class +// member template. +template struct X1<float>; // expected-error{{explicit instantiation of undefined template}} + +template<typename T> +struct X2 { // expected-note 4{{refers here}} + template<typename U> + struct Inner; // expected-note{{declared here}} + + struct InnerClass; // expected-note{{forward declaration}} +}; + +template struct X2<int>::Inner<float>; // expected-error{{explicit instantiation of undefined template}} + +// A definition of a class template shall be in scope at the point of an +// explicit instantiation of a member function or a static data member of the +// class template. +template void X1<int>::f1(int); // expected-error{{incomplete type}} \ + // expected-error{{does not refer}} + +template int X1<int>::member; // expected-error{{incomplete type}} \ + // expected-error{{does not refer}} + +// A definition of a member class of a class template shall be in scope at the +// point of an explicit instantiation of the member class. +template struct X2<float>::InnerClass; // expected-error{{undefined member}} + +// If the declaration of the explicit instantiation names an implicitly-declared +// special member function (Clause 12), the program is ill-formed. +template X2<int>::X2(); // expected-error{{not an instantiation}} +template X2<int>::X2(const X2&); // expected-error{{not an instantiation}} +template X2<int>::~X2(); // expected-error{{not an instantiation}} +template X2<int> &X2<int>::operator=(const X2<int>&); // expected-error{{not an instantiation}} |
